Tile backsplash installation services involve the process of selecting, preparing, and securely affixing tiles to the walls in kitchens, bathrooms, or other interior spaces. Professionals typically handle tasks such as surface preparation, layout planning, cutting tiles to fit around fixtures or corners, and applying grout to ensure a durable and visually appealing finish. The goal is to enhance the aesthetic appeal of a space while providing a protective barrier that guards walls against moisture, stains, and splashes. Proper installation ensures the tiles are level, securely adhered, and resistant to damage over time, contributing to the overall durability of the area.
This service helps address common problems associated with wall surfaces in high-moisture areas. For instance, it can prevent water infiltration that might lead to mold or structural damage. Additionally, a well-installed tile backsplash can cover up existing wall imperfections or outdated finishes, providing a fresh and modern look. It also simplifies cleaning and maintenance, as tiles are easier to wipe down and less prone to staining compared to painted or wallpapered surfaces. Material Costs - The cost of tiles for a backsplash typically ranges from $5 to $50 per square foot, depending on material choice. For example, ceramic tiles might cost around $10 per square foot, while glass or natural stone can be $30 or more. Material prices can significantly affect the overall project budget.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or generally costs between $20 and $50 per hour, with total costs depending on the size of the area. A standard kitchen backsplash might require 8-16 hours of work, translating to $160 to $800 for labor alone. Rates may vary based on local pros’ experience and complexity of the design.
Project Scope - The total cost depends on the size of the backsplash and the complexity of the pattern or design. For a typical 10-square-foot area, costs can range from $300 to $1,200, including materials and installation. Larger or more intricate projects tend to increase overall expenses.
Additional Fees - Extra costs may include surface preparation, removal of old tiles, or repairs, which can add $100 to $300. These fees vary based on the condition of the existing wall and specific project requirements.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on individual need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of tiles are suitable for a backsplash? Many options are available, including ceramic, glass, porcelain, and natural stone tiles, suitable for various styles and preferences.
How long does tile backsplash installation typically take? The duration depends on the size and complexity of the area, but most installations can be completed within a day or two.
Can a tile backsplash be installed over existing surfaces? Yes, in many cases, a new tile backsplash can be installed over existing surfaces if they are in good condition.
What should be considered when choosing a tile backsplash design? Factors include the overall kitchen style, color coordination, tile material, and pattern preferences.
